Company description
Profile
Tapestry, Inc. is a prominent provider of luxury accessories and branded lifestyle products across markets in the United States, Japan, Greater China, and beyond. Operating through three primary segments—Coach, Kate Spade, and Stuart Weitzman—the company offers an extensive array of women's accessories, which include handbags, wallets, money pieces, wristlets, and cosmetic cases. Additionally, it features novelty accessories such as address books, time management tools, travel items, sketchbooks, and portfolios, along with key rings and charms. Tapestry's product mix also incorporates various bag collections, including business cases, computer bags, messenger-style bags, backpacks, and totes, as well as a range of small leather goods like wallets, card cases, travel organizers, and belts. The company caters to customer needs with footwear, watches, fragrances, sunglasses, and ready-to-wear items for both men and women. Seasonal lifestyle apparel for women includes outerwear and cold weather accessories, while it also offers children's housewares, such as fashion bedding and tableware, stationery, and gifts. The company has monetized its brand through licensing agreements for tech and soft accessories, jewelry, watches, eyewear, and fragrances under the Coach label, as well as diverse product lines under the Kate Spade brand.
